What Are Rubber Bushes? Functions and Key Uses
Rubber bushes (also called rubber bushings) are cylindrical components made from durable rubber materials designed to:
- Act as shock absorbers in machinery and vehicles
- Reduce noise and vibration
- Connect metal parts while allowing limited movement
- Protect equipment from damage and wear
- Extend the life of mechanical systems
- Provide electrical isolation when needed
- Accommodate misalignment between components
- Prevent metal-to-metal contact
- Compensate for manufacturing tolerances
How Do Rubber Bushes Work?
Rubber bushes work by flexing and absorbing energy that would otherwise cause vibration, noise, and damage. The rubber material compresses and expands as needed, providing a cushioning effect while maintaining the connection between components.
The specific formulation of rubber determines the following properties:
- Elasticity Range: How much the bush can flex before returning to its original shape
- Damping Capacity: How effectively it absorbs energy
- Durability: How long it maintains its properties under stress
- Chemical Resistance: How well it withstands oils, fuels, and other substances
- Temperature Tolerance: How it performs in hot or cold environments

Below are the most commonly used types of rubber bushes and their applications:
1. Natural Rubber Bushes
- Made from latex harvested from rubber trees (Hevea brasiliensis)
- Excellent elasticity with 500-1000% elongation capability
- Superior vibration dampening and noise reduction properties
- Good tear resistance and compression set recovery
- Temperature range: -60°F to 180°F (-51°C to 82°C)
- Vulnerable to degradation from UV light, ozone, and petroleum products
- Common applications: Motor mounts, suspension bushings in non-critical environments
2. Nitrile (NBR) Rubber Bushes
- Synthetic rubber made from acrylonitrile and butadiene
- Excellent resistance to petroleum-based oils, fuels, and hydraulic fluids
- Good abrasion resistance and moderate compression set
- Temperature range: -40°F to 250°F (-40°C to 120°C)
- Lower elasticity than natural rubber (200-500% elongation)
- Available in different acrylonitrile content percentages (18-50%) for varied oil resistance
- Common applications: Automotive fuel systems, hydraulic components, oil-exposed parts
3. Neoprene (CR) Rubber Bushes
- Polychloroprene synthetic rubber
- Excellent resistance to weather, ozone, and UV degradation
- Good flame resistance (self-extinguishing properties)
- Moderate oil and chemical resistance
- Temperature range: -40°F to 230°F (-40°C to 110°C)
- Good aging properties with minimal hardening over time
- Common applications: Outdoor equipment, marine applications, electrical insulation

5. Silicone Rubber Bushes
- Exceptional temperature resistance range
- Retains flexibility at extremely low temperatures
- Excellent UV, ozone, and oxidation resistance
- Poor tear strength and abrasion resistance
- Relatively high cost compared to other rubber types
- Low tensile strength but maintains properties over long periods
- Common applications: High-temperature environments, food processing equipment, medical devices
6. Polyurethane Rubber Bushes
- Extremely high load-bearing capacity (up to 5x that of rubber)
- Superior abrasion and tear resistance
- Excellent resistance to oils, solvents, and ozone
- Temperature range: -30°F to 220°F (-34°C to 104°C)
- Higher hardness options available (60-95 Shore A)
- Can be formulated for specific applications with varied hardness
- Common applications: Heavy machinery, mining equipment, high-load suspension systems
7. Viton (FKM) Rubber Bushes
- Premium fluoroelastomer with exceptional chemical resistance
- Outstanding resistance to high temperatures up to 400°F (204°C)
- Excellent resistance to fuels, oils, and aggressive chemicals
- Low compression set even at elevated temperatures
- Higher cost than most other rubber types
- Limited low-temperature flexibility below -15°F (-26°C)
- Common applications: Chemical processing equipment, aerospace, high-temperature engines
8. SBR (Styrene-Butadiene Rubber) Bushes
- Most widely used synthetic rubber worldwide
- Good abrasion resistance and aging properties
- Cost-effective alternative to natural rubber
- Temperature range: -40°F to 200°F (-40°C to 93°C)
- Moderate resistance to petroleum products
- Better heat resistance than natural rubber
- Common applications: Tires, conveyor belts, general industrial applications

Rubber Bushes vs Polyurethane Bushes: Which Is Right for You?
Choosing the right material for your bushings is essential as it impacts performance, durability, and cost. Understanding the differences between rubber and polyurethane helps you make an informed decision.
Comparing Material Properties
Each material offers distinct advantages that make them suitable for different applications:
Rubber Bushes: Advantages and Ideal Uses
- Softer Feel: Greater comfort and vibration absorption
- Lower Cost: More economical for most applications
- Better Noise Dampening: Superior sound isolation properties
- Greater Flexibility: More forgiving during installation
- Temperature Stability: Consistent performance across various temperatures
Polyurethane Bushes: Advantages and Ideal Uses
- Higher Durability: Longer lifespan in high-stress applications
- Greater Load Capacity: Can handle heavier weights
- Better Chemical Resistance: Superior performance with oils and fuels
- Less Compression Set: Maintains shape better over time
- Higher Cost: Premium price for premium performance

How to Choose the Right Rubber Bush for Your Application
Selecting the appropriate rubber bush involves understanding both your equipment requirements and the operating environment. Making the right choice ensures optimal performance and maximum service life.
What factors should I consider when buying rubber bushes?
When selecting rubber bushes, consider these important factors:
- Load Requirements: How much weight will the bush need to support?
- Environmental Conditions: Will the bushes be exposed to heat, chemicals, or weather?
- Required Flexibility: How much movement should the bush allow?
- Space Constraints: What are the dimensional requirements?
- Durability Needs: How long should the bush last in your specific application?

How to Know When Rubber Bushes Need Replacement
Regular inspection helps identify deteriorating bushes before they cause equipment damage or failure. Knowing the warning signs ensures timely replacement.
Here are signs that indicate your rubber bushes might need replacement:
- Visible cracks or deterioration
- Increased noise or vibration
- Uneven wear on connected components
- Reduced performance of equipment
- Oil or fluid leakage around the bush area
